EIBAR. SD Eibar overcomes Burgos 1-0 after J. Bautista scored just 1 goal (33′). SD Eibar made the most of its better ball possession (58%).

The match was played at the Estadio Municipal de Ipurúa stadium in Eibar on Saturday and it started at 4:15 pm local time. In front of 5,950 spectators.​ The referee was Iván Caparrós Hernández with the assistance of Javier García Lorenzo and Christian García Andreu. The 4th official was José Alberto Pardeiro Puente. The weather was cloudy. The temperature was pleasant at 15.8 degrees Celsius or 60.4 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 96%.​

Ball possession

SD Eibar had a strong ball possession 58% while Burgos was struggling with a 42% ball possession.

Attitude and shots

SD Eibar was putting more pressure with 47 dangerous attacks and 13 shots of which 7 were on target. This is one of the reasons why SD Eibar won the match​.

SD Eibar shot 13 times, 7 on target, 3 off target. Regarding the opposition, Burgos shot 9 times, 2 on target, 3 off target.

Cards

SD Eibar received 2 yellow cards (Matheus Pereira and Peru Nolaskoain). Regarding the opposition, Burgos received 2 yellow cards (Raúl Navarro and Gaspar Campos).

Standings

After this match, SD Eibar will have 59 points to remain in the 1st place. On the other side, Burgos will stay with 45 points to hold in the 7th place.

Next matches

In the next match in the La Liga 2, SD Eibar will host FC Andorra on the 26th of March with a 1-0 head to head in favor of FC Andorra (0 draws).

Burgos will play away agasint UD Ibiza on the 25th of March with a 2-1 head to head statistic in favor of Burgos (0 draws).
